Oligonucleotide design meets big data:
We present oligoN-design, a simple, reproducible and versatile open-source tool to design specific primers and probes directly from large environmental DNA datasets.

Despite 150+ years of Radiolaria diversity research, we have just scratched the surface. Nearly half of Radiolaria diversity might be naked hiding in plain sight! We unveiled the diversity and evolution of Radiolaria beyond "the stars of the ocean"

Adding planktonic algae to anoxic marine sediments promotes the anaerobic growth of phagotrophic #eukaryotes. The #Neoproterozoic Rise of Algae may have similarly promoted benthic phagotrophs, directing carbon, energy, and nutrients to early animals. #ProtistsOnSky

The Rise of Algae promoted eukaryote predation in the Neoproterozoic benthos
The rise of marine algae stimulated microbial predation at the seafloor, rerouting carbon and energy to the earliest animals.
